Abstract
The circumstances in which cardiorespiratory arrest may occur and
cardiopulmonary resuscitation be necessary are highly variable and in certain conditions, basic life support and
advanced life support interventions may require modifications in relation to the general recommendations and have
physiological influence on rescuers. For this reason, specific adaptive training programs should be assessed in
certain special environments, such as high altitude, high ambient temperatures or when dealing with people with
infectious diseases.
